Great program! it saved my day for reading comics, since the MOBI and EPUB readers don't seem to recognize "full screen" (also called panel view) epubs or mobis, as those produced by KindleComicConverter.
I personally use a program named Mangle to produce the cbz at the pocketbook's resolution, so that pages load quicker. Just select the "Kindle DX" profile, and there you go. https://github.com/proDOOMman/Mangle Looking at pbimageviewer's source code, I think it should not be very difficult to add PDF reading functionality, using the lightweight mupdf library, which basically renders a PDF page to a bitmap. The PDF contrast can be adjusted using a "gamma" parameter, and this would make a nice alternative PDF reader to the crappy reader that's included with the PocketBook (which has wrong gamma settings in my opinion). The kindle community did a very nice integration of mupdf + CoolReader3 in a tool called kindlepdfviewer: https://github.com/hwhw/kindlepdfviewer/wiki Has anybody thought of integrating PDF reading to pbimageviewer, or do you think it should be a separate tool? |

I had thought about this a while ago (a year?), and I was excited by the idea at the beginning, but I got less so over time. I'm not sure I remember all the details, but I think a part of it is that internal links would be a big complication. Most of the simple actions (key strokes, pointer presses) are already being used for image-related operations. Adding new actions that people have come to expect for PDFs (links, search, columns, history, notes,...) starts to look more and more painful (especially considering the small number of buttons on the 611).
If the idea is to not bother with those complications and just treat each page as an image, then using something like k2pdfopt to convert the original PDF to a new PDF of images seems to make more sense to me. You can use it to resize the contents to better fit the device, and can get around a lot of the issues with gamma and antialiasing in the native PB apps. I've tried it myself, and it makes the PDF much easier to read, but found that I really start to miss those PDF-specific features. I expect the same thing would happen if I did a half-assed port into pbimageviewer. So, if the idea is to port over mupdf, then I think it should go into its own application. I don't have time for such a job, but if you're interested, I could help a bit with the PocketBook-specific stuff (i.e libinkview) if you went ahead with it. |

As requested, I've added a couple of new features. First, the ability to automatically restart an archive at the beginning if it was last exited at the end. Second, the ability to automatically start the next archive in the same directory when you try to read past the end of the current archive (a dialog pops up, shows what the next file is, and asks if you want to open it). Both features need to be enabled in the configuration before they work.
@dtanis has also supplied a full Dutch translation and a partial Japanese translation. The latter will be finished later when time permits. PascalV and seiichiro018 have also graciously updated the French, Portuguese and German translations for the latest features to be added. |
